WebGRASS is a community group open to residents of the Grassmarket and streets leading off it and to anyone with an interest in the area. Our aims are to foster good community relations, organise local events, encourage sustainable improvements and engage with planning and development issues that affect the area. WebThe Grassmarket Community Project offers a mixture of education programs, social enterprise and social integration activities. Currently these are delivered through cookery, gardening, woodwork ... WebThe Grassmarket Cafe, found at the Grassmarket Community Project, is a great place to grab a coffee or a light lunch. The food is great value and tasty, and as a bonus, it all supports the charitable work of the community project. You can also pay it forward and give someone in need a breakfast or lunch.
